DALLAS (105.3 The Fan) - The Dallas Stars have agreed to a three-year, $9.45 million deal with center Roope Hintz, the club announced Monday.
The new deal with keep Hintz in Dallas through the 2022-23 season. He'll earn an average of $3.15 million per year, general manager Jim Nill said.
Hintz, 23, had a career-high 19 goals and a career-best 14 assists in 60 games played last season.
The former 2015 second-round pick had two goals and 11 assists in 25 playoff games.
